Chris Rock on Friday evening refused to speak in regards to the second he was slapped by Will Smith on stage on the 2022 Oscars ceremony.

"I am OK, I've an entire present and I am not speaking about that till I receives a commission. Life is sweet. I acquired my listening to again," the comic and presenter stated throughout his present at Fantasy Springs on Friday evening, in response to the California-based Desert Solar newspaper.

Rock was struck by Smith through the March 27 Academy Awards ceremony after the comic made a joke about Smith's spouse, Jada Pinkett Smith, who suffers from alopecia—an autoimmune situation that causes hair loss.

Rock joked that Pinkett Smith ought to star in G.I. Jane 2 due to her look. He was making reference to the 1997 movie G.I. Jane during which actress Demi Moore shaved her head.

"Jada, I really like ya. G.I. Jane 2, cannot wait to see ya," Rock stated on the 94th Academy Awards.

Smith then abruptly stood up from his seat and slapped Rock throughout the face onstage, earlier than returning to his seat and yelling, "Maintain my spouse's identify out your f**king mouth."

Avoiding dialogue of the Will Smith slap, Rock's set on Friday consisted of jokes in regards to the Kardashians, Meghan Markle, and Hillary Clinton in response to the newspaper.

Rock had briefly addressed the controversial incident at a sold-out present in Boston, Massachusetts, on March 30.

"How was YOUR weekend?" Rock requested the group at Boston's Wilbur Theatre. "I am nonetheless processing what occurred, so in some unspecified time in the future I will speak about that sh*t."

Rock instructed the group that when he did determine to speak in regards to the incident, it might be humorous but additionally critical.

"It will be critical. It will be humorous, however proper now I'll inform some jokes," Rock stated.

"Let me be all misty and sh*t," Rock continued. "I haven't got a bunch of sh*t to say about that, so in case you got here right here for that...I had written an entire present earlier than this weekend."

Smith, who received an Oscar for King Richard on the ceremony, has publicly apologized for the incident.

"I wish to publicly apologize to you, Chris," Smith stated in a press release on March 28. "I used to be out of line and I used to be unsuitable. I'm embarrassed and my actions weren't indicative of the person I wish to be. There is no such thing as a place for violence in a world of affection and kindness."

The Academy of Movement Image Arts and Sciences on Friday introduced that Smith has been banned from all Academy occasions, together with the Oscars, for 10 years, over the slapping incident.

"I settle for and respect the Academy's resolution," Smith stated in a press release, responding to information of the decade-long ban.
